Output ab6a80801daa94d613af7027cb7f8356789bca57031d32036fd5ab2983d2c047:52

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53de9586fd696dbe558373d5539a386dfb708794 OP_EQUAL
address
39LUesxizthhU5dVP28Vm3jZju2cT5sEEs
transaction
ab6a80801daa94d613af7027cb7f8356789bca57031d32036fd5ab2983d2c047
spent
true